Frequently Asked Questions

What are the closest trade schools to Cummaquid, MA, and what programs do they offer?

The closest trade schools to Cummaquid are Cape Cod Regional Technical High School in Harwich, Upper Cape Cod Regional Technical School in Bourne, and Southeastern Technical Institute in South Easton. These schools offer programs such as Automotive Technology, Carpentry, Electrical, HVAC, Plumbing, Cosmetology, Culinary Arts, and Welding, providing local residents with accessible vocational training options.

What local job opportunities are available for trade school graduates in the Cummaquid and Cape Cod area?

Graduates in trades like Carpentry, Electrical, HVAC, and Plumbing find strong demand in Cummaquid and across Cape Cod due to the region's construction, renovation, and seasonal tourism industries. Additionally, Automotive Technology and Cosmetology graduates can secure positions at local dealerships, repair shops, and salons, leveraging the area's year-round and seasonal economy.

Are there any apprenticeship programs in Cummaquid, MA, that partner with local trade schools?

While Cummaquid itself is a small village, nearby trade schools like Upper Cape Cod Regional Technical School often collaborate with local unions and businesses on Cape Cod to offer apprenticeship programs. For example, electrical and plumbing trades may have partnerships with local contractors, providing hands-on experience while students complete their certifications.

What certifications can I earn through trade schools near Cummaquid, and how do they benefit my career?

Programs at schools like Southeastern Technical Institute and Cape Cod Regional Technical High School prepare students for industry-recognized certifications such as EPA 608 for HVAC, OSHA safety credentials, and state licensing in Cosmetology or Electrical work. These certifications are crucial for securing employment and advancing in high-demand trades on Cape Cod, ensuring graduates meet local and state regulatory standards.
